Children going through divorce often experience a wide range of emotions, including sadness, confusion, anger, or worry about the future. They may struggle with changes in their daily routines, moving between homes, or adjusting to new family dynamics. Divorce can also affect their sense of security and belonging, making it important for caregivers and professionals to provide consistent support, reassurance, and a safe space to express their feelings.
